Mandrake Disk 2 & 3 install/other ???


Hello,

I downloaded Mandrake 8.1 from linuxiso.org, burned the CD, and installed it just fine. I noticed during the download process that there were iso images for a disk 2 and 3. I was told (by someone on another message board) to download and install disk 1, so that's what I did. During the install process I was promted to insert disk 2 (if I had it) or press cancel to continue the install of the current disk.

Everything is fine and Mandrake is up and running but now I'm curious; do I need to install disk 2 and 3? What is on them? How do they install? Will I have to manually configure a bunch of stuff, or will they install themselves? disc 2 generally contains developement pacakges and additional libraries. if you want to compile programs under linux (which you probably will, as many programs come as source code) then you're likely to need to install a number of these packages. cd 3 just contains other stuff really, additional apps, games etc... that you might want. just use the Software Manager to browse through all the applications on all the cd's, and install anything that looks nifty.
